If you’re ready to take the next step in your career, CEDA has opportunities for you! CEDA is looking to hire Project Manager for our Fort McMurray, AB location. CEDA will be working with one of their clients to reassemble their entire dredge, as well as assemble a marina and an electrical barge on site. The Project Manager is responsible for planning, executing, and overseeing all aspects of an assigned Dredging Project. This includes managing scope, schedule, cost, and quality to ensure safe and efficient project delivery that meets client expectations. The Project Manager works closely with Operations, Maintenance, and HSE teams to ensure compliance with technical and contractual requirements while fostering strong customer relationships.
